Working Principle of 0362020.H Fuses
The working principle of 0362020.H fuses is quite simple. They contain a metal alloy filament that has high electrical conductivity, but at the same time has a low melting temperature. When the current exceeds the set value, the filament melts due to the overheating in the extremely short time. This stops the electric current from flowing, hence eliminating all the possibilities of a short circuit or overload.
